While it might be some sort of stretch to call up “Casino” a genuine story, it has been based on some true events that happened in Vegas during the 1972s. Several of the particular characters inside the film had real-life equivalent with somewhat related stories. As Typically the Mob Museum details out, Ginger Rothstein was based about former Las Las vegas showgirl Geri Rosenthal. Her husband, Outspoken “Lefty” Rosenthal, served as the basis for Ginger’s husband Sam “Ace” Rothstein, and his field with all the gaming commission was based in a real-life occasion.

The explosions and fireworks are demonstrated during the hotels’ destructions and future constructions symbolize the mob’s loss associated with control over Vegas and replacement by faceless corporations. The mob’s prior control of the city seemed to be like their accommodations — all-powerful and even able to tower system over everything around the strip. But it ended in some sort of spectacular eruption involving corruption and assault, forever ending virtually any chance that this mafia could rebuild their own Vegas empire plus start again. The penultimate scene associated with “Casino” shows each of the mob’s hotels staying blown up plus razed. In their place, new casinos and attractions are shown being created, like the Mirage and the massive volcano near its entry.
